    @camptrst 7 лет назад +13

    I absolutely love my Braava. I use it every day. I can't believe how dirty the floor gets in one day. It does a great job on dog hair. The Braava has troubles going around LaziBoy furniture. THe furniture rocks and sometimes traps the Braava when it rocks back down. I have to watch my Braava when she is in the family room. I am amazed at how well she works under our kitchen table with chairs around the table.

    @meg3839 10 лет назад +15

    This thing works pretty well for in-between moppings, as well as when it comes to dusting the floor. It's a time saver if you're like me and want your floors clean, but don't have time to mop several times a week, and is very quiet.
    The dusting clothes aren't great, though, but it's also designed to work with Swiffer dry cloths, which work great. Why wasn't that shown?
    I'm all for honest reviews but this isn't a full-on mop replacement, nor are half the test materials realistic for most households. Or at least I hope not :/
